SB 290 Core Teaching & Admin Standards must: Provide multiple measures-encompass a range of behaviors Provide evidence of student academic growth Be research-based Be separately developed for teachers and administrators Be customized based on collaboration of teachers, administrators, & bargaining reps.
11
Evaluation must attempt to: Strengthen knowledge, skills, disposition and practices Refine the support, assistance and professional growth based on individual needs Establish a growth process that supports professional learning Use evaluation methods, professional development, support targeted to individual needs
12
SB 290 – Public Comment Require at least 4 performance levels in evaluation Student Academic growth & learning as a significant factor in educator evaluations
